How Outsourced Call Centers Fuel Business Growth Beyond Saving Money
When leaders think about outsourcing their call center operations, the first advantage that usually comes to mind is lowering costs. While reducing expenses is valuable, the real impact of outsourcing reaches far beyond the budget line. Done well, it becomes a driver of growth, efficiency, and stronger customer relationships.
At EMS, we have seen how partnering with the right call center transforms customer service into a business advantage. Here are four ways outsourcing helps organizations grow:
- Scaling Without Disruption
Every business goes through cycles of change. Busy seasons, product rollouts, or sudden increases in customer inquiries can overwhelm an in-house team. Outsourced call centers give companies the flexibility to expand or contract support as needed, without the stress of hiring, training, or restructuring staff. This flexibility keeps operations running smoothly no matter what the demand looks like.
- Specialized Skills and Compliance
Operating a call center requires more than just people on phones. It involves technology, ongoing training, and compliance with industry standards. In healthcare, for example, EMS agents are trained to follow HIPAA requirements to protect sensitive patient data. Outsourcing connects companies to specialized knowledge and resources they might not be able to build internally.
- Elevating the Customer Experience
Customer satisfaction is not only about quick answers—it is about consistent, thoughtful service that represents a brand well. Trained professionals know how to listen, resolve issues, and create a positive experience for each caller. When businesses outsource with EMS, they gain a partner dedicated to building loyalty and trust through every interaction.
- Space to Focus on What Matters Most
Customer support is vital, but it is not the only priority for growing companies. By outsourcing, business leaders free up time and energy to focus on innovation, strategy, and long-term goals. Instead of managing day-to-day call volume, they can put their attention where it has the greatest impact: driving the business forward.
